Understanding VIN Verification: What It Entails and Why It’s Essential

VIN verification is a critical process that ensures the authenticity and integrity of a vehicle’s identification number (VIN). This unique 17-character code serves as a digital fingerprint for every car, truck, and SUV. A reliable VIN verifier, often a vin inspector, delves into this numerical sequence to unearth vital information about the vehicle’s history, including its original manufacturer, model year, assembly plant, and more. It’s essential because it helps verify that the vehicle is indeed what it claims to be, preventing fraud and ensuring safety for both buyers and sellers.

When you’re considering a used vehicle purchase or selling your own, engaging a vin inspector for verification becomes paramount. This process includes cross-referencing the VIN with reputable databases, such as those maintained by the DMV, to confirm the vehicle’s history, identify any outstanding issues, and ensure it hasn’t been reported as stolen. A vin verified vehicle instills confidence in buyers, knowing they’re making an informed decision, while sellers can showcase transparency and peace of mind, enhancing their market appeal.

The Role of a VIN Verifier or Inspector: Expertise and Responsibilities

A VIN verifier or inspector plays a crucial role in ensuring that vehicles undergoing transfer or repair meet safety and legal standards. Their expertise lies in thoroughly inspecting and verifying every aspect of a vehicle’s Vehicle Identification Number (VIN), which is a unique code that identifies specific characteristics of a car, including its make, model, year, and production details. With their keen eye for detail, these professionals are responsible for cross-referencing the VIN against official records, checking for any discrepancies or signs of tampering, and confirming that the vehicle’s history aligns with what is documented.

The responsibilities of a VIN verifier extend beyond basic inspection. They often work closely with DMVs (Department of Motor Vehicles) to ensure accurate vin verification, facilitating smooth transactions during sales, auctions, or salvage operations. By employing advanced tools and databases, they can quickly access and validate vehicle history reports, including accident records, title details, and previous ownership changes. This meticulous process helps protect buyers and sellers from potential fraud, ensuring that every ‘vin verified’ vehicle is safe and compliant for road usage.

Step-by-Step Guide to Los Angeles' VIN Verification Process

In Los Angeles, ensuring your vehicle’s authenticity and history is straightforward through the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) verification process.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you navigate this crucial check:

1. Locate Your VIN: Start by finding your car’s VIN, typically found on a plate near the driver’s side door or in the glove compartment. It’s a 17-character code that serves as a unique identifier for your vehicle.

2. Choose a Vin Verifier: You can verify your VIN through various official channels. The Los Angeles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) offers this service, and there are also reputable third-party vin inspectors who can provide accurate verification. These services use advanced technology to cross-reference your VIN with national databases, ensuring it’s not stolen or has any outstanding issues.

3. Submit Your VIN: Once you’ve selected a trusted vin verifier, submit your VIN through their online platform or by contacting them directly. They’ll access the vehicle history report, which includes details like ownership history, accident reports (if any), and maintenance records.

4. Receive Verification: After processing, you’ll receive a comprehensive verification report outlining the findings. If your VIN is valid and clear, you’ll be provided with a ‘vin verified’ status, ensuring peace of mind when buying or selling a vehicle in Los Angeles.

Common Issues and Tips for Ensuring a Smooth VIN Verification Experience

The V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) verification process in Los Angeles can be a straightforward procedure or a bureaucratic nightmare, depending on your preparation and awareness of potential issues. Common problems include incorrect or incomplete documentation, miscommunication between parties, and discrepancies between the vehicle’s reported history and its actual condition. To ensure a smooth experience: always gather all necessary documents before scheduling an appointment with a trusted vin verifier or vin inspector. This includes registration papers, insurance cards, and any previous maintenance records. Additionally, be prepared to discuss any known or suspected issues with your vehicle’s history, as these may impact the verification process.

When looking for a reliable service, consider opting for a professional vin inspection near me that has established credibility and positive reviews from past clients. Ensure the vin inspector is equipped to handle both basic and complex verifications, especially if you have an older or imported vehicle. Regularly updating your knowledge about the local DMV vin verification requirements can also help avoid delays or misunderstandings.
